"    Fox argued in its own counterclaim that Dominion's lawsuit should be dropped because the company had only filed the suit "to punish [Fox News Network] for reporting on one of the biggest stories of the day — allegations by the sitting President of the United States and his surrogates that the 2020 election was affected by fraud," the Fox filing reads
